Eventflowslicer: A Goal-Based Test Case Generation Strategy For Graphical User Interfaces, Jonathan Saddler Aug 2016

Eventflowslicer: A Goal-Based Test Case Generation Strategy For Graphical User Interfaces, Jonathan Saddler

Department of Computer Science and Engineering: Dissertations, Theses, and Student Research

Automated test generation techniques for graphical user interfaces include model-based approaches that generate tests from a graph or state machine model of the interface, capture-replay methods that require the user to specify and demonstrate each test case individually, and modeling-language approaches that provide templates for abstract test cases. There has been little work, however, in automated goal-based testing, where the goal is a realistic user task, a function, or an abstract behavior.
